Neil Morrice: UK Racing Tips – Tuesday 9 July 2019

Tips Today - Tuesday - Horse Racing - Hollywoodbets

Neil Morrice brings us all of his best bets and tips for Tuesday’s racing at Wolverhampton, Brighton, Uttoxeter and Pontefract. 


Wolverhampton Best Bet

Race 4: FORUS (3) (Each Way)
Trainer: Jaime Osborne
Jockey: Nicola Currie

Although not able to get into the money FORUS caught my eye on his Lingfield debut and could easily leave that effort a fair way behind. As a 25-1 roughie he dwelt at the start but when straightening kept on encouragingly to finish only four and a half lengths adrift of the winner Miss Matterhorn. This might not be the warmest of heats in which case FORUS can get into the shake-up.

Brighton Best Bets 

Race 3: MOMENTARILY (3)
Trainer: Mick Channon
Jockey: Callum Shepherd

Since changing stables MOMENTARILY showed a first modicum of ability when third in a Class 6 here a week ago and now drops back in trip but up in grade. The hood she wears at home is not evident but this is a poor race and if she can find even a small amount of improvement she can prevail.

Race 4:: YOU’RE HIRED (1)
Trainer: Amanda Perrett
Jockey: Pat Dobbs

The giant YOU’RE HIRED has to look back a long way to his last win but his trainer appears to have find a terrific chance for him in a race that is sure to turn into a tactical battle. He wasn’t beaten far when posting a mid-division finish at this level on the Kempton Polytrack last month and he just gets the nod over recent Newcastle scorer Francophilia.

Uttoxeter Best Bets 

Race 2: PACIFY (2)
Trainer: Jamie Snowden
Jockey: Gavin Sheehan

This features some interesting prospects but now that he’s shown he can cut the mustard over hurdles, PACIFY should prove very hard to beat for a stable that is in form and gave us a nice winner on Sunday. The 7yo was easily the best of these on the Flat and has his tail up after getting up close home to beat Purple King, who is a good yardstick, at Southwell.

Race 7: TAKINGITALLIN (3)
Trainer: Donald McCain
Jockey: W Kennedy

Three in this mares’ handicap hurdle are last time out winners but the one with the best credentials is TAKINGITALLIN. She has placed in each of her last six outings and when scoring at Newton Abbot last time made every yard without ever looking like being reeled in. It is an open race but she should have the measure of Slaine and Organdi.

Pontefract Best Bets

Race 3: PATTIE (9) (Each Way)
Trainer: Mick Channon
Jockey: Ben Curtis

With form lines tieing in a number of these the race cries out value and PATTIE will give us that in abundance. There’s not much to choose between her and Colin Coulis on Chelmsford running back in March and my selection ran well back there as a 50-1 shot in the race won by Billesdon Brook last month. She has also shown a liking for this track, having placed in the corresponding race 12 months ago.

Race 5: MECCA’S GIFT (5)
Trainer: Michael Dods
Jockey: Conor Beasley

MECCA’S GIFT hails from a family that get better with age and following a wide margin triumph at Hamilton, for which she carries a 6lb penalty, she can go in again. The blinkered 3yo faces interesting opposition from Li Kai and Garrison Commander but after that seven lengths demolition job she can take this step up the class ladder in her stride.
